WHAT DOES THE BARNACLE DO?
The BARNACLE is an electronic switch device which adds intelligence to an ordinary bilge pump. The BARNACLE uses a novel method to remotely sense whether or not there is liquid in a contained space. Not only does the BARNACLE know if there is liquid present, but it also knows if there is ENOUGH liquid for a centrifugal pump to work effectively to pump the liquid out of that space.
WHAT MAKES THE BARNACLE DIFFERENT THAN A REGULAR FLOAT SWITCH?
The BARNACLE is nothing like a regular float switch. For starters, it has no moving parts. It doesn’t need to be located in the bilge at all and can be installed anywhere on a boat. The installation is a simple inline wire connection between the power source and the bilge pump with only 3 wires to connect. The electronics are completely sealed in epoxy and are impervious to most corrosive liquids. It will work for any 12v DC centrifugal bilge pump between 360 gph – 2,000 gph. Various pump models have been tested from every international manufacturer we could find. It requires no calibration upon installation and can be switched between different models and makes as needed.
WHAT ABOUT THE EXTRA FEATURES?
The BARNACLE has an adjustable timing feature which allows the user to control how often the water checks are performed. This helps to optimize for timing related to the amount of water ingress, or optimize differently for less power consumption in times of mooring/docking or storage. The BARNACLE has several safety features which give it even more value to our customers. The internal circuits include an over-voltage diode which protects the switch and reverse polarization protection. Both help to protect the product in case the customer makes a faulty installation or the electronics on the boat experience a short. Additionally, low voltage, over voltage, pump jam, standby mode and active pumping are all signaled separately by a bright LED light. The Barnacle conserves power by turning on the bilge pump only when there is liquid present, and stopping the pump within micro-seconds of the pump running out of water.
